HARD TRUTH: many itinerant teachers find themselves running on empty.

If you’re closing out your year feeling frazzled and stretched too thin, you’re not alone. The itinerant model is one of the most rewarding yet demanding roles in special education—and it’s all too easy to lose your footing in the shuffle of multiple schools, diverse caseloads, and endless IEP meetings.

Many itinerant teachers of the deaf are ending the year:

  • Tired of sitting in their car while their to-do list grows

  • Frustrated that the best intentions didn’t materialize

  • Questioning if they can keep this pace up another year

If this is you, you’re not alone—and you’re not failing. The itinerant model is simply not sustainable without structure, systems, and support.

Challenge #1: You felt scattered and unsupported.

No one else in your district truly get what you do. You worked in isolation, made decisions without a sounding board, and constantly second-guessed your impact.

 


 

Challenge #2: Teachers didn't understand your students’ needs.

You tried to inservice 10+ staff members across multiple schools, and still, your students are sat in classrooms without access or advocacy.

 


 

Challenge #3: Your students relied on you for advocacy and access.

You wanted to build independence, but your students weren't yet self-advocating. You’re worried they’re not ready for middle school, high school—or life.
